Output d6176dbbc0b51225098656d1250cc866a9353467e898ee37563dbfa2399f83ee:5

value
91000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ee317e25349956ff2e6818115d7a60b8f74111 OP_EQUAL
address
3MZKu8i9c3nQo4aY4z6TNaTpYPKq3vq3XQ
transaction
d6176dbbc0b51225098656d1250cc866a9353467e898ee37563dbfa2399f83ee
confirmations
69682
spent
true